This is probably my favorite memory of Jim Leyland as Tigers’ manager.
On the night they clinched their third consecutive AL Central title, he could’ve just as easily been in the clubhouse celebrating with the rest of the team.
But there he is, sitting and pouring his heart out to fans in the city of Detroit and state of Michigan, who paid their hard-earned money to watch his team in the years following an economic recession.
His genuine selflessness is exactly why he’ll always be beloved by Tiger fans.
